Is the Splunk Enterprise Certified Admin Worth It? Honest Review & ROI Analysis
Deciding whether to pursue the Splunk Enterprise Certified Admin certification involves weighing its practical value against the investment of time and money. This certification targets individuals responsible for the day-to-day management and operational support of a Splunk Enterprise environment. It validates a specific skillset: installing, configuring, and maintaining Splunk deployments, managing data inputs, and ensuring system health. For many, the question isn't just about obtaining a credential, but about its tangible impact on career trajectory, earning potential, and overall professional competence. This analysis delves into the "worth" of this certification, examining its relevance, potential salary implications, and the real-world scenarios where it makes a difference.
Splunk Enterprise Certified Admin: Understanding the Core Value
The Splunk Enterprise Certified Admin certification (SPLK-3001) isn't merely a badge; it signifies a validated understanding of Splunk's operational backbone. It's designed for those who actively manage Splunk instances, from single-server deployments to distributed environments. The core value lies in demonstrating proficiency across several critical domains:
- Installation and Configuration: This includes setting up Splunk, understanding deployment topologies (standalone, distributed, clustered), and configuring basic settings. Without this foundational knowledge, managing any Splunk environment becomes a series of reactive fixes rather than proactive maintenance.
- Data Ingestion: A primary function of Splunk is getting data in. The certification covers various data input methods (files, network, scripts, APIs), parsing rules, and indexing strategies. An administrator who can efficiently ingest data ensures that the right information is available for analysis, minimizing data loss and optimizing performance.
- Index Management: Understanding how data is stored, indexed, and aged is crucial for performance and compliance. The certification addresses index creation, management, and retention policies. Mismanaged indexes can lead to performance bottlenecks, storage issues, or failure to meet data retention requirements.
- User and Role Management: Security and access control are paramount. The certification covers creating and managing users, roles, and permissions within Splunk, ensuring that only authorized individuals can access and manipulate specific data or functionalities.
- Monitoring and Troubleshooting: Real-world Splunk environments encounter issues. The certification equips administrators with the knowledge to monitor Splunk's health, diagnose common problems, and troubleshoot performance issues. This includes understanding internal logs, diagnostic tools, and best practices for maintaining a robust system.
The practical implication of this certification is direct: it validates the skills necessary to keep a Splunk environment running smoothly and efficiently. An organization investing in Splunk relies heavily on administrators who can ensure data availability, system performance, and security. For an individual, it signals to potential employers that they possess these critical, hands-on capabilities.
However, there are trade-offs. The certification focuses heavily on the administrative aspects, not on advanced search language (SPL) development, app creation, or security-specific use cases. While foundational knowledge of SPL is necessary, the depth required for a power user or architect is beyond this exam's scope. Therefore, someone looking to specialize in security analytics or complex dashboarding might find this certification a necessary stepping stone but not the ultimate destination.
Consider a scenario: A company has recently deployed Splunk Enterprise to consolidate logs from various IT systems. They are experiencing slow search times and data ingestion backlogs. An administrator without formal training might struggle to identify the root cause, perhaps resorting to generic server troubleshooting. A Splunk Enterprise Certified Admin, however, would systematically check indexer performance metrics, data input queues, parsing configurations, and search head resource utilization. They would be equipped to diagnose whether the issue stems from inefficient data onboarding, improper index configurations, or overloaded search heads, leading to a faster resolution and minimal operational disruption. This concrete example illustrates the direct value an administrator with certified expertise brings to the table.
Passing the Splunk Enterprise Certified Admin Exam: Insights and Realities
Many who have successfully navigated the Splunk Enterprise Certified Admin exam (SPLK-3001) share common experiences and advice, often highlighting the need for practical experience alongside theoretical knowledge. The "AMA" (Ask Me Anything) format frequently seen in community forums provides valuable insights into the exam's difficulty and preparation strategies.
The exam itself is generally regarded as challenging but fair, provided the candidate has hands-on experience. It's not a test of rote memorization alone. While understanding concepts from the official Splunk training courses (Splunk Enterprise System Administration and Splunk Enterprise Data Administration) is fundamental, the exam often presents scenario-based questions that require applying that knowledge to practical problems.
Key insights from those who have passed often include:
- Hands-on Experience is Paramount: While formal training provides the theoretical framework, actively working with Splunk – installing instances, configuring inputs, managing indexes, and troubleshooting issues – solidifies understanding. Many recommend setting up a personal Splunk lab (even on a virtual machine) to experiment with different configurations and break things deliberately to learn how to fix them.
- Focus on Documentation and Best Practices: Splunk's official documentation is a treasure trove of information. The exam often tests knowledge of recommended configurations and architectural guidelines, which are well-documented. Understanding why certain configurations are preferred over others is crucial.
- Time Management During the Exam: The exam has a strict time limit (typically 90 minutes for 65 questions). Candidates often advise practicing under timed conditions to get comfortable with the pace. Some questions can be lengthy, requiring careful reading to identify the core problem being asked.
- Understanding Distributed Environments: A significant portion of the exam deals with distributed Splunk deployments, including indexer clusters, search head clusters, and deployment servers. Knowing the roles of each component, how they communicate, and how to manage them is critical. This often trips up candidates who have only worked with standalone instances.
- Specific Areas of Focus: Recurring themes in post-exam discussions include:
- Configuration Files: Knowledge of
server.conf, inputs.conf, outputs.conf, indexes.conf, props.conf, and transforms.conf is essential. Understanding the order of precedence for settings across different files and locations is often tested.
- Deployment Server: How to use it for distributing configurations and apps to forwarders and other Splunk components.
- Licensing: Understanding different license types and how they impact data ingestion and features.
- Troubleshooting Commands: Familiarity with commands like
splunk btool, splunk show status, and understanding Splunk's internal logs (splunkd.log, metrics.log).
A common trade-off is the cost and time investment in preparation. The official Splunk training courses are not inexpensive, and while self-study is possible, many find the structured environment and hands-on labs of the official courses to be invaluable. For those with limited budget, leveraging Splunk's free developer license for a personal lab and meticulously going through documentation and online community resources can be an alternative, but it requires significant self-discipline.
For example, a candidate might encounter a question about a forwarder that isn't sending data to an indexer cluster. The options might include checking outputs.conf, verifying network connectivity, or restarting the universal forwarder. A certified admin would know to first check outputs.conf on the forwarder to ensure the correct indexer cluster members are listed and that useACK is properly configured, then proceed to network checks if the configuration is correct. This methodical approach, directly tested by the exam, is a hallmark of a competent Splunk administrator.
Splunk Certifications, Salary, and Career Prospects
The Splunk Enterprise Certified Admin certification can significantly boost your salary and career prospects, especially when you combine it with practical experience. While no certification guarantees a specific income, this credential often helps you stand out in a competitive job market and can lead to higher compensation.
Salary Increase Potential:
Based on various industry reports and anecdotal evidence from professionals, individuals holding the Splunk Enterprise Certified Admin certification often command higher salaries than their uncertified counterparts. The actual increase varies based on location, years of experience, company size, and specific job responsibilities. However, a 10-20% salary bump is not uncommon for individuals who obtain this certification and can demonstrate practical application of the skills.
For instance, an IT professional with 3-5 years of experience might see their salary move from the mid-$80,000s to the low-$100,000s or higher, especially in regions with high demand for Splunk expertise. More experienced professionals, particularly those moving into senior admin or architect roles, would find this certification a baseline requirement rather than a significant increase driver, but it validates their foundational knowledge.
Career Prospects and Value:
The career value of the Splunk Enterprise Certified Admin certification extends beyond just salary. It opens doors to specific roles and demonstrates a commitment to the Splunk platform.
- Increased Job Opportunities: Many job descriptions for Splunk Administrator, Splunk Engineer, or Security Operations Center (SOC) Analyst roles explicitly list Splunk certifications as "preferred" or "required." This certification helps candidates stand out.
- Validation of Skills: Employers often struggle to assess a candidate's true Splunk proficiency during interviews. A certification provides an objective, third-party validation of a core skillset.
- Foundation for Advanced Roles: The Enterprise Certified Admin is often considered a prerequisite or a strong foundation for more advanced Splunk certifications, such as the Enterprise Certified Architect or Enterprise Security Certified Admin. These higher-level certifications build upon the administrative knowledge.
- Internal Mobility and Project Assignments: Within organizations already using Splunk, certified administrators are often prioritized for critical projects, system upgrades, or roles requiring deeper platform expertise. This can lead to greater responsibility, visibility, and further career growth.
- Consulting Opportunities: For those interested in consulting, certifications are often a minimum requirement to demonstrate credibility and expertise to clients.
However, a certification isn't a substitute for practical experience. Someone with years of hands-on Splunk experience might be more valuable than a newly certified professional with no practical background. Ideally, you'd have both: certification validates your knowledge, and experience shows how you apply it in real-world situations.
Comparison of Certification Levels and Career Impact:
| Certification Level |
Focus |
Typical Role |
Initial Career Impact |
| Splunk Core Certified User |
Basic searching, reporting, dashboarding |
Junior Analyst, Data Explorer |
Entry-level proficiency, understanding of basic Splunk functions. Limited direct salary impact. |
| Splunk Core Certified Power User |
Advanced searching, complex reports, data models |
Analyst, Power User, Junior Engineer |
Enhanced analytical skills, ability to create more sophisticated content. Moderate salary impact. |
| Splunk Enterprise Certified Admin |
Installation, configuration, administration, maintenance |
Splunk Admin, Operations Engineer, SOC Engineer |
Significant impact. Validates core operational skills, often a requirement for dedicated Splunk roles. Strong salary impact. |
| Splunk Enterprise Certified Architect |
Distributed deployment design, advanced troubleshooting, scaling |
Splunk Architect, Senior Engineer, Consultant |
High impact. Expertise in complex, large-scale Splunk environments. Commands top-tier salaries. |
| Splunk Enterprise Security Certified Admin |
Deploying & managing Splunk ES, security content |
Security Engineer, SIEM Admin, Security Analyst |
High impact in security domain. Specialized skills for security operations. Strong salary impact. |
The Splunk Enterprise Certified Admin sits at a critical juncture, moving from user-level proficiency to foundational administrative expertise, making it a pivotal certification for those aiming for dedicated Splunk roles.
Cost Analysis: Investing in the Splunk Enterprise Certified Admin Certification
Understanding the financial investment required for the Splunk Enterprise Certified Admin (SPLK-3001) certification is a crucial part of the "worth it" equation. The costs primarily break down into training and the exam fee itself.
1. Official Splunk Training Courses:
Splunk strongly recommends, and most successful candidates attest to the value of, completing two official courses:
- Splunk Enterprise System Administration (Course SPLK-240): This course covers the installation, configuration, and management of Splunk Enterprise components, including indexers, search heads, and forwarders. It typically runs for 3 days.
- Splunk Enterprise Data Administration (Course SPLK-250): This course focuses on data ingestion, field extraction, data parsing, and index management. It generally runs for 2 days.
Cost Estimate for Official Training:
As of early 2025, the approximate costs for these courses, if purchased individually from Splunk, can be substantial:
- Splunk Enterprise System Administration: Around $2,500 - $3,000 USD
- Splunk Enterprise Data Administration: Around $2,000 - $2,500 USD
Total Estimated Training Cost: $4,500 - $5,500 USD
Many organizations offer "Splunk Education Passes" or include training as part of larger software contracts, which can significantly reduce or eliminate out-of-pocket costs for employees. For individuals, these costs are a primary barrier.
2. Exam Fee:
After completing the recommended training (or self-studying), candidates must pay for the certification exam.
- Splunk Enterprise Certified Admin Exam (SPLK-3001): The exam fee is typically $125 USD.
3. Potential Indirect Costs:
- Study Materials: While official courseware is comprehensive, some individuals might purchase third-party practice exams, study guides, or supplementary books. These costs are usually minor ($50-$200).
- Personal Lab Setup: If you're building a home lab for hands-on practice, there might be costs associated with cloud resources (AWS, Azure, GCP) or virtual machine software licenses, though free tiers and open-source options can minimize this.
- Time Investment: The time spent studying and attending courses is a significant, albeit unquantifiable, cost. For the two official courses, you're looking at 5 full days of instruction, plus many hours of self-study and practice.
Total Estimated Out-of-Pocket Cost (without employer sponsorship): $4,625 - $5,625 USD
ROI Considerations:
When evaluating the Return on Investment (ROI), it's essential to compare this cost against the potential benefits:
- Salary Increase: As discussed, a 10-20% salary increase for a professional earning $80,000-$100,000 annually translates to an extra $8,000-$20,000 per year. This means the certification cost could be recouped within the first year, or even within months, depending on the individual's situation.
- Job Opportunities: For those seeking to enter the Splunk ecosystem or advance within it, the certification can be a critical gateway. The "cost of not being certified" might be missed job opportunities or slower career progression.
- Employer Sponsorship: Many employers recognize the value of certified Splunk administrators and are willing to cover the training and exam costs. This significantly shifts the ROI calculation, making the certification a "no-brainer" for the employee. If your employer uses Splunk, inquire about their training budget or education programs.
Comparison of Self-Study vs. Official Training:
| Feature |
Official Training Courses |
Self-Study (Documentation, Free Lab) |
| Cost |
High ($4,500 - $5,500+) |
Low (Exam fee $125 + minimal lab/study material costs) |
| Structure |
Guided curriculum, expert instructors, official labs |
Self-paced, relies on self-discipline and research |
| Depth of Knowledge |
Comprehensive, covers exam topics directly |
Variable, depends on individual's research and practice |
| Hands-on Practice |
Integrated labs, controlled environment |
Requires setting up personal lab, potentially less guided |
| Time Investment |
5 full days of courses + self-study |
Potentially more hours for research and practice |
| Exam Readiness |
Generally high, designed to prepare for the exam |
Requires significant effort to ensure coverage |
| Employer View |
Highly regarded, often preferred |
Less formal validation, relies on demonstrated skills |
For individuals whose employers will sponsor the training, the official courses offer the most direct and efficient path to certification. For those self-funding, the decision involves weighing the significant upfront cost against the potential for higher earnings and career advancement, with self-study being a viable but more challenging alternative.
Conclusion
The Splunk Enterprise Certified Admin certification holds genuine value for individuals committed to a career in IT operations, security, or data analytics where Splunk is a core platform. It's not a mere resume booster but a validation of practical, in-demand skills in managing a complex enterprise system. While the financial investment in training can be substantial, particularly without employer sponsorship, the potential for increased salary, enhanced career opportunities, and improved job security often presents a compelling return on investment.
For those directly responsible for Splunk deployments, or aspiring to such roles, the certification provides a structured path to expertise and a recognized credential that differentiates them in the job market. Its worth is most evident when combined with hands-on experience, demonstrating not just theoretical knowledge but the practical ability to keep Splunk environments running efficiently and securely. Ultimately, if your professional trajectory aligns with the operational management of Splunk, investing in the Enterprise Certified Admin credential is a strategic move that is likely to pay dividends.